Description

The Portable Radiation Package (PRP) was deployed for the ARM MAGIC field campaign and provided quality measurements of shortwave and longwave downwelling radiation in the moving, obstructed shipboard environment. The PRP consisted of a PSP-PIR (RAD) system and a SPN1 broadband total-diffuse shortwaves sensor on both the port and starboard sides of the ship and a Fast-Rotating Shadowband Radiometer (FRSR) for narrowband direct beam solar irradiance. The poster describes available data, overall quality, and validation from intercomparisons with the NOAA observatory in Boulder, CO and with the NASA Microtops MAN observations.
